About Karur

Karur is a rural settlement in Samudrapur, Wardha, Maharashtra. It has a population of 500 in about 126 households (avg size: 3.97). Approximate literacy: 75%.

Population of Karur

Population (Total)500
Male264
Female236
Children (0–6 years)47
Households126
Literate persons375
Illiterate persons125
Total workers300
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)894
Literacy (approx.)75%
SC population152
ST population162
